Direct Answer
No, you cannot buy legendary skins with Legacy Credits. However, you can use them to purchase skins that were available in the previous games, including Epic and Legendary skins from Overwatch 1.
Understanding Legacy Credits
Legacy Credits are the new currency in Overwatch 2, and they can be earned through various methods, including progressing through Seasonal Battlepasses and playing the game. These credits can be used to purchase skins, but they cannot be used to buy brand-new legendary skins that debut in Overwatch 2.
Why Can’t You Buy Legendary Skins?
The reason you cannot buy legendary skins with Legacy Credits is that these skins are exclusive to the Overwatch 2 Shop and require Overwatch Coins or real-money purchases. Legacy Credits can only be used to buy skins that were available in the previous games, making it a way to revamp your existing skin collection.
